The 4 to 11 (Primary) QTS Programme at Bromley Schools' Collegiate is an excellent opportunity for graduates passionate about working with young children. This programme is specifically designed for those who wish to gain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) in order to teach within the Primary age range, from Reception to Year 6. As a full-time training programme, it allows trainees to gain practical, hands-on experience while receiving high-quality training and support .
This course involves two placements in primary schools within the borough of Bromley, ensuring that trainees receive valuable experience across a broad age range. With a strong emphasis on child-centred teaching, trainees will learn how to address the diverse learning needs of young students, develop inclusive teaching strategies, and focus on the holistic development of children.
The programme offers an opportunity to become a reflective practitioner, with guidance from experienced mentors and facilitators who are drawn from our partner schools. As a trainee, you will engage in research-informed practice to continually improve your teaching skills and develop subject-specific expertise.
